Inclusion

  • 12 to 80 years old.
  • Documented history of physician-diagnosed asthma for one year or more. (Verified by medical records)
  • Using a stable daily ICS/LABA regimen.
  • Willing to undergo multiple pulmonary function tests throughout the study.
  • Willing to change current asthma treatment.
  • Willing to use an effective contraceptive throughout the study.

Exclusion

  • Life threatening asthma defined as significant episodes requiring intubation.
  • Currently on biological therapy for asthma.
  • Other serious respiratory issues such as COPD, bronchiectasis, tuberculosis, etc.
  • History of drug or alcohol abuse.
  • Narrow angle glaucoma or changes in vision.
  • Cancer not in complete remission for at least 5 years.
  • Depot corticosteroid use within the last year.
  • Regular use of a nebulizer for receiving asthma medications.
  • Planning to become pregnant during the course of the study.
